🥘 Ingredients

10 items
  • 2 large sweet potatoes
  • 400 ml coconut milk
  • 100 grams gran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 0.5 te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 0.25 teaspoon salt
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ter (melted)

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 180°C (350°F) and grease a medium-sized baking dish with butter or non-stick spray.

2

Peel the sweet potatoes, cut them into chunks, and boil in a pot of water for 15-20 minutes or until tender. Alternatively, you can steam them.

3

Drain the sweet potatoes and mash them in a large mixing bowl until smooth. Allow them to cool slightly.

4

In a separate bowl, whisk together the coconut milk, granulated sugar, eggs, melted butter, and vanilla extract.

5

Gradually add the wet ingredients to the mashed sweet potatoes, mixing thoroughly to combine.

6

Sift in the all-purpose flour, ground cinnamon, ground nutmeg, and salt. Stir until the mixture is smooth and all ingredients are well incorporated.

7

Pour the sweet potato mixture into the prepared baking dish and spread it out evenly with a spatula.

8

Bake in the preheated oven for 35-40 minutes, or until the top is lightly golden and the pudding is set but still slightly jiggly in the center.

9

Remove the pudding from the oven and let it cool for 10-15 minutes. It will firm up further as it cools.

10

Serve warm or at room temperature. For an extra touch, garnish with whipped cream, toasted coconut flakes, or a sprinkle of cinnamon, if desired.
